Looks like we don't need to worry about this. According to No 'Hot Pass' for DirecTV customers next year

"DirecTV will not continue its exclusive NASCAR “Hot Pass” pay-per-view package next season, The Observer and ThatsRacin.com have learned. "

I read thru it and it seems that it may be back BUT not like it was as HP. It reads like it may be more like it was back in the InDemand days or even a free coverage channel of some sort. Some quotes to support that:

- NASCAR spokesman Ramsey Poston confirmed changes to DirecTV’s broadcast platform for NASCAR.

- “The produced package as it exists today will change,” he said. “There will be no more large production pieces but we are confident DirecTV will have NASCAR content next season.

- “We are working with DirecTV on a package that will hopefully provide fans some of the same enhancements they received with ‘Hot Pass.’ ”

- Poston said a new package, minus the driver-specific broadcasts, could be made available to all DirecTV subscribers, thus expanding the reach of NASCAR coverage on DirecTV. The “Hot Pass” program required an additional subscription for those who already had DirecTV.

- I think the subscription package is going to change for the better for more fans, ultimately,” Poston said
